Output 734dc69e5a100aea15186e5966e73dcb59c0bd3ca523972da5367bd8a1d68a62:84

value
23286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4b33b3610fa9c3bb6b7547a70fd6d0eed90d36 OP_EQUAL
address
3N3ghSngywfhBaWodd2Ph4bE6FaHEsksxu
transaction
734dc69e5a100aea15186e5966e73dcb59c0bd3ca523972da5367bd8a1d68a62
spent
true